Understanding the Basics: What Is NFT Staking?
NFT staking follows a similar principle to staking traditional cryptocurrencies like Ethereum or Cardano. By locking up your NFT in a smart contract on a platform, you can start earning rewards. These rewards can range from additional NFTs to the platform’s native token or a share of transaction fees. NFT Projects With Passive Income: Current Trends
To earn passive income through NFT staking, you’ll want to look for specific types of projects with earning potential:
1. Play-to-Earn Games: Platforms like MOBOX and Axie Infinity allow players to stake in-game items to earn rewards over time.
2. Virtual Real Estate: Projects like Decentraland and The Sandbox offer virtual land as NFTs, allowing you to develop, rent, or stake them for a share of platform revenues.
3. Utility and Membership Tokens: NFTs that function as business stocks or VIP tickets can offer governance votes or a share of platform fees when staked.

How to Earn Passive Income With NFT Staking
To start earning passive income through NFT staking, follow these steps:
1. Select a Reputable Platform: Choose a platform with proper documentation, active communities, and audited smart contracts.
2. Own or Buy the Right NFTs: Ensure your desired NFT is accepted by the staking platform you choose.
3. Lock Your NFT: Connect your wallet, navigate to the staking section, and lock your NFT in the smart contract.
4. Collect Rewards: Earn rewards in the form of tokens, additional NFTs, or a share of transaction fees. Keep an eye on your stake in case you need to unstake and regain access to your NFT.
